What are the legal restrictions on insider trading?

Insider trading is the practice of buying or selling a security, such as stocks or bonds, using information that is not available to the general public. Insider trading is illegal in Oklahoma and in many other states. Under the law, a person with access to material, nonpublic information is prohibited from trading or attempting to trade based on that knowledge. This applies to both corporate insiders, such as executives and board members, and people outside the company with access to nonpublic information. The legal restrictions on insider trading are clear: a person must not use or pass on private information for the purpose of trading in the stock market. If a person trades in securities while aware of material, nonpublic information, they could be subject to civil and criminal penalties, including jail time, fines, and other sanctions. In addition, those suspected of insider trading may also have to pay back any profits they made and may have to turn over the insider information to the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The SEC has issued a number of rules and regulations to prevent insider trading, and those found guilty of violating these rules can face penalties including civil or criminal action.
